Chemical Property of (E)-1-(2-Bromovinyl)-4-methoxybenzene Edit
Chemical Property:
  • Vapor Pressure:0.00544mmHg at 25°C 
  • Melting Point:50-55°C 
  • Boiling Point:125-140 °C / 3 mm 
  • Flash Point:112.1°C 
  • PSA:9.23000 
  • Density:1.41g/cm3 
  • LogP:3.06080 
  • Storage Temp.:Amber Vial, Refrigerator, Under Inert Atmosphere 
  • Solubility.:Acetonitrile (Slightly), Chloroform (Slightly), Ethyl Acetate (Slightly) 
  • XLogP3:3.1
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:1
  • Rotatable Bond Count:2
  • Exact Mass:211.98368
  • Heavy Atom Count:11
  • Complexity:126
